9. Objects / A. Existence of Objects / 3. Objects in Thought
There are objects of which it is true that there are no such objects [Meinong]
Meinong says an object need not exist, but must only have properties [Meinong, by Friend]
9. Objects / A. Existence of Objects / 4. Impossible objects
Meinong said all objects of thought (even self-contradictions) have some sort of being [Meinong, by Lycan]
The objects of knowledge are far more numerous than objects which exist [Meinong]

14. Science / D. Explanation / 2. Types of Explanation / i. Explanations by mechanism
Modern mechanism need parts with spatial, temporal and function facts, and diagrams [Glennan]
Mechanistic philosophy of science is an alternative to the empiricist law-based tradition [Glennan]
Mechanisms are either systems of parts or sequences of activities [Glennan]
17th century mechanists explained everything by the kinetic physical fundamentals [Glennan]
Unlike the lawlike approach, mechanistic explanation can allow for exceptions [Glennan]
